Year-Round Home for Manhattan's Times Square New Year's Eve Ball

NEW YORK (AP)  -- Happy new year, again!
   
The famous Waterford crystal ball that descended in Times Square to ring in 2009 is being lit again and sent back up a 141-foot flagpole, where it will remain year-round.
   
The new ball, 12 feet in diameter, weighing nearly 12,000 pounds, and covered with 2,668 Waterford Crystal triangles, will now have a permanent home on the roof of One Times Square.
   
The ball will be raised midway up the mast on Tuesday, where it will stay until the next new year's celebration.
   
Organizers say the ball will also celebrate other holidays including Valentine's Day, the Fourth of July and Halloween.
